Another thought. While servicing, drain the gearbox and put in straight 140 gear oil. It does make a big difference and makes gear changing easier. Hi Frank, and welcome to the forum. Re the front engine mounts, it sounds like perhaps the rubber bushes under the engine bearer have compressed - a common problem solved with new bushes. So I decided to clean up the chassis frame myself, rather than having it blasted. It was a LOT more work, but gave me the chance to closely inspect every inch of it for damage or potential issues - there were none.
